With latest Builds HQ Upscaling is not usable on my two Clients (see Signature). I got a lot dropped or skipped Frames. With Scaling set to Bilinear everything is fine. Think i have to update the Hardware to be ready for latest Kodi Builds.

(2016-07-07, 00:40)john.cord Wrote: With latest Builds HQ Upscaling is not usable on my two Clients (see Signature). I got a lot dropped or skipped Frames. With Scaling set to Bilinear everything is fine. Think i have to update the Hardware to be ready for latest Kodi Builds.

When you say "With latest builds", are you saying that HQ scaling has worked OK at some point in the recent past but now doesn't (if so, which is the first build that is "bad"?)

Or has HQ scaling never really worked on your two clients, as Lanczos (which I believe is the HQ scaler) may be much for your hardware.

I set Kodi to use HQ Scaling above 20% and Scaling to Lanczos 3. I dont encounterd issus since the latest two or three builds but i cannot specify a build without further testing. But i read thate with this two machines Bilinear is the better and safest choice to avoid performance issues. I thought about new hardware but i think i wait for Kaby Lake to upgrade my clients.
